Baked Creamed Spinach

ingredients

2 pounds fresh spinach
2 tablespoons butter
2 tablespoons flour
1 1/2 cup hot milk
1 teaspoon salt
1/4 teaspoon black pepper
1/4 teaspoon nutmeg
1 cup grated Cheddar cheese

directions

Trim spinach; wash well in several changes of water. Place in large pot with water clinging to leaves. Cover; cook only until wilted. Cool. Gently squeeze out excess water.

In medium saucepan, melt butter; add flour. Whisk and cook gently without browning for a few minutes. Add milk; bring to a boil. Add salt, pepper and nutmeg. Cook 5 minutes.

Combine spinach with sauce and half the grated cheese. Spoon into 1 1/2 quart baking dish. Sprinkle with remaining cheese. Just before serving, bake at 350 degrees F for 20 minutes or until bubbly.

nutrition data

286 calories, 19 grams fat, 16 grams carbohydrates, 17 grams protein per serving.
